  7. Ann Prentiss (November 27, 1939 – January 12, 2010) was an American actress. She appeared in one episode of Hogan's Heroes, The Missing Klink, as Ilse.She died in prison, January 12, 2010, in Chowchilla, California, having served 13 years of a 19 year prison sentence (expected release date 2016) for assaulting her father, and threats against three other members of her family.
